President to open Performing Arts Theatre
President Mahinda Rajapaksa will open the country's first Performing
Arts Theatre-Nelum Pokuna (Lotus Pond) Mahinda Rajapaksa theatre
tomorrow. This Performing Arts Theatre donated by the People's Republic
of China is a symbol of the centuries old friendship between the two
countries closely interwind with Buddhism. A high level Chinese
delegation will participate in the opening ceremony.
This theatre constructed according to a model of the historic Lotus
Pond or Nelum Pokuna in Polonnaruwa has been built on the former Nomads
grounds in Colombo 07.
It portrays an attempt made by the government to create opportunities
for the people's entertainment at a time when the liberated country is
steered towards the progress. The total expenditure incurred was Rs 3.08
billion with Chinese aid. The theatre consists of all modern amenities.
It also consists of a movable stage and state-of-the-art sound control
systems. The main auditorium has a seating capacity at 1,288 persons. It
has a library, rehearsal halls and parking facility for 500 vehicles.
The Theatre is a gift to the performing arts sector of the country and a
valuable asset to the nation.
